The Queen’s Master of International Business program enables you to earn a world-class degree in 12 months.Program Structure

The single degree option is structured in three stages, and a major, team-based project spans all three.Stage 1

The first stage is held at Queen’s. During the first module, you will be placed on your Learning Team, with whom you will collaborate on course assignments and the development of your team-based International Consulting Project topic. During this module, you will complete the program’s three core courses. Prior to starting the elective courses in module 2, you will work with an experienced advisor to select the two elective courses that align with your background and career aspirations.Stage 2

This stage takes place on the campus of one of our international business school partners. Carefully selected, these schools are known both nationally and internationally as centres of excellence in business education. All classes at these schools are conducted in English. A study program includes a selection of courses on relevant topics, including language study as appropriate. During this stage, you will conduct research and gather data for your International Consulting Project.Stage 3

During this stage, you will complete your International Consulting Project and present it to your peers, faculty, and industry experts. This can be done in person at Queen’s, or remotely from another location.

A successful candidate will typically meet the following requirements:

? A four-year (or international equivalent) undergraduate degree in business from a recognized university. (Note: We will consider candidates who do not have a full undergraduate degree in business if they meet certain requirements. Please visit our website for more information.)? Two strong references, one of which must be academic.? If applicable, an acceptable score on the GMAT and/or an acceptable score on one of the approved English facility tests (TOEFL, IELTS, or MELAB). No work experience is required. However, candidates with work experience are also welcome to apply.

? Candidates with a Bachelor’s degree in business who have

achieved a B+ average in their final 2 years are not required to write the GMAT.? Candidates with a Bachelor’s degree in business who have not achieved a B+ average in their final 2 years are required to write the GMAT and achieve an overall score of 550 or better.? Candidates who have a Bachelor’s degree in another discipline are required to write the GMAT and achieve an overall score of 550 or better.Please note, you will not be penalized for writing the GMAT more than once. We will consider only your best score. (In some instances, we will consider candidates with GMAT scores below 550 if their application is otherwise exceptional.)
